3
respostas

[Dúvida] Qual a forma correta de escrever o código ?

console.log('Valor do chute:', chute);

ou

console.log(Valor do shute ${chute});

3 respostas
  1. Opção. É válido o uso de ('texto', valor) pois a virgula separa os argumentos (string e variável).

Oi Lehi,

A forma correta e mais recomendada de concatenar strings com variáveis em JavaScript é utilizando template string (strings delimitadas por crases) e a sintaxe `${variavel}`.

No seu caso, ficaria assim:

console.log(`Valor do chute: ${chute}`);

Essa abordagem é mais legível e evita erros comuns ao usar a concatenação com o operador +.

A outra forma que você apresentou, console.log('Valor do shute:', chute);, também funciona, mas ela adiciona um espaço entre a string e a variável, o que pode não ser o resultado desejado em todos os casos. 👍

Para saber mais: Template literals (Template strings) - Documentação da MDN sobre template literals em JavaScript.

Continue praticando e explorando as diferentes formas de trabalhar com strings! 💪 💻

Obg pelas dicas grande Luis!